Bumblebee Director's Next Project Could be the Live-Action Masters of the Universe Movie - Report

Bumblebee director Travis Knight's next project may be the long-awaited Masters of the Universe movie. Deadline reports that Knight is in final negotations to direct the movie, which is rumored to be heading to Amazon after being dropped by Netflix over budget concerns.

Knight boasts a background in both live-action and animation, having directed the acclaimed Kubo and the Two Strings in addition to Bumblebee, which we called the "best live-action Transformers movie since the 2007 film."

According to Deadline's report, Knight will team up with Chris Butler to rewrite the initial draft of the script, which will reportedly be an origin story of sorts for He-Man. The film has been in various stages of development since at least 2007, with Kyle Allen set to play He-Man. Netflix dropped the project in 2023 after spending $30 million on the film's development

Despite the various setbacks the film has faced over the years, Mattel seems determined to get it done. The series has found success in animated releases like Masters of the Universe: Revelation, and a live-action version has been long-anticipated by fans.

Of course, this wouldn't be the franchise's first foray into live-action. Dolph Lundgren took on the famous role of He-Man back in 1987 in a film that has come to be regarded as a campy cult classic. For more, check out our guide to watching the Transformers movies in chronological order.
